- The evolving VAT landscape, driven by regulations like ViDA and eInvoicing, is shifting VAT compliance from a reactive necessity to a strategic opportunity, offering real-time data-driven insights and competitive advantages for CFOs.
- Leveraging technology in VAT delivers measurable value through improved cash flow and faster refunds, enhanced operational insights beyond just tax issues, and increased speed and agility for market expansion.
- While technology is crucial for automation and standardization, human expertise is indispensable for designing VAT logic, interpreting complexities, and defending positions during audits, highlighting the need for strong governance and viewing AI as a co-pilot, not an autopilot.
